Panama Canal Cruise, Off To The Airport In The Morning

It is Friday, April 13th. I catch my flight to Fort Lauderdale tomorrow morning, but I am not worried at all.  I followed my check list and I am ready to go.

ONE WAKE-UP AND I AM ON MY WAY!!!

A year’s worth of planning and it is almost time to take our cruise of a lifetime.

I guess I better get my checklist out and go over everything one last time..

  • Finalize packing, check!
  • Confirm flight times and print out boarding passes, check!
  • Confirm shuttle service, check!
  • Confirm hotel reservations, check!
  • Make sure to put your passports, confirmation paperwork and cruise docs in carry-on, check!
  • Set alarm and go to sleep.

I am still wondering about staying in touch.  I have read everything that I can find, but I still wonder.  I know that we will purchase a package of minutes of computer time so that we can stay in touch. Don’t expect my cell phone to work as anything but a camera until we make it to Puerto Vallarta.  I have put everything that I need to have handy in my carry-on bag: Tickets, passports, confirmations, cruise docs, money, meds, cameras, books, e-reader, chargers, etc…
